Jerome is correct in writing that we are not far off from seeing some pretty tough hits on Barack Obama, whether from right wing groups or the McCain campaign/RNC, but it looks like Obama won't be the only one sustaining some shots between now and election day. Take a look at these spots now going up on air:
Planned Parenthood
Campaign Money Watch
California Nurses Association
Looking at these advertisements -- the fact that they are hitting the McCain-Palin ticket from multiple angles, and aren't pulling punches -- it would be difficult to say that groups on the left aren't taking this race seriously. And with indications that the favorable ratings of both John McCain and Sarah Palin have slipped noticeably in the past two weeks, it's probably not a bad idea to keep the pressure on over the next 34 days so that even as the McCain campaign tries to drag down Obama's numbers through tough negative hits the Republicans' numbers won't have much chance of moving up at the same time.
